Michael D. Arrington, Petitioner(s) v. William E. Gregory, et al., Respondent(s)


Lower Tribunal No(s). 3D2013-1836; 132009CA025472000001

Because Petitioner has failed to show a clear legal right to the relief requested, he is not entitled to mandamus relief. Accordingly, the petition for writ of mandamus is hereby denied. See Huffman v. State, 813 So.2d 10, 11 (Fla. 2000). No motion for rehearing will be entertained.

CANADY, LABARGA, GROSSHANS, FRANCIS, and SASSO, JJ., concur.
